首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Searchview筛选器不适用于包含已解析JSON的列表,但适用于非JSON列表

Searchview筛选器是Android开发中的一个组件,用于在列表中进行搜索和筛选操作。它通常用于非JSON列表,即普通的文本列表。

当列表中的数据是已解析的JSON格式时,Searchview筛选器不适用。这是因为JSON数据通常是嵌套的,包含了多层次的结构,而Searchview筛选器只能对一维的文本列表进行搜索和筛选。

对于包含已解析JSON的列表,我们可以考虑使用其他方式来实现搜索和筛选功能。一种常见的方法是使用RecyclerView和自定义适配器来展示列表数据,并结合EditText和按钮等组件来实现搜索和筛选功能。具体实现方式可以根据具体需求进行设计和开发。

腾讯云提供了丰富的云计算产品和服务,可以帮助开发者构建和管理各种应用。以下是一些与云计算相关的腾讯云产品:

  1. 云服务器(CVM):提供弹性计算能力,可根据实际需求弹性调整计算资源。 产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高可用、可扩展的关系型数据库服务,适用于存储和管理数据。 产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 云存储(COS):提供安全、稳定、低成本的对象存储服务,适用于存储和管理各种类型的数据。 产品介绍链接:https://cloud.tencent.com/product/cos
  4. 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,可用于图像识别、语音识别、自然语言处理等应用场景。 产品介绍链接:https://cloud.tencent.com/product/ailab

请注意,以上仅是腾讯云的一部分产品,更多产品和服务可以在腾讯云官网上查看。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

后端返回给前端数据格式有哪些?

后端返回数据格式有很多种,常见包括JSON、XML、HTML、CSV等。这些格式各有特点,适用于不同应用场景。...它基于JavaScript子集,数据格式简洁,方便读写,同时也方便机器解析和生成。JSON用于Web应用程序中数据交换和传输。...通过将数据嵌入HTML中,前端浏览可以解析并显示这些数据。 CSV(Comma Separated Values):CSV是一种以逗号分隔文本文件格式,常用于存储表格数据。...CSV文件包含一系列行和列,每行表示一个记录,每列表示一个字段。CSV格式简单、易读、易写,也易于用各种程序解析和生成。...然而,CSV不适合存储复杂数据结构或包含大量文本数据(如二进制数据)数据。 除了以上几种常见格式外,还有其他一些格式如Protocol Buffers、YAML等也常用于后端返回数据。

23110

Microsoft REST API指南

例如,例如,当服务返回 JSON 对象中字段顺序发生变化,客户端应当能够正确进行解析处理。 当服务端支持时,客户端可以请求以特定顺序返回数据。...许多HTTP标头在RFC7231中定义,但是在IANA标头注册表中可以找到完整批准头列表。...不需要cookie或任何其他形式[用户凭证] cors-user-credentials资源可以使用通配符星号(*)进行响应。请注意,通配符仅在此处可接受,而不适用于下面描述任何其他标头。...$orderBy 参数包含用于对项目进行排序表达式列表,用逗号分隔。 这种表达式特殊情况是属性路径终止于基本属性。...可能已过滤列表根据排序条件进行排序。 分页。经过筛选和排序列表上显示了实现分页视图。这适用于服务驱动分页和客户端驱动分页。 10.

4.5K10

pcc —— PHP 安全配置检测工具

https://github.com/sektioneins/pcc 概念 一个便于分发单文件 有对每个安全相关 ini 条目的简单测试 包含一些其他测试 - 但不太复杂 兼容 PHP >= 5.4...然后,添加参数 -a 以便更好查看隐藏结果, -h 以 HTML 格式输出, -j 以 JSON 格式输出. WEB: 复制这个脚本文件到你服务任意一个可访问目录,比如 root 目录。...在 CLI 模式下默认输出 HTML 格式。可以通过修改设置环境变量PCC_OUTPUT_TYPE=text 或者 PCC_OUTPUT_TYPE=json改变这个行为。...showall=1,这并不适用于 JSON 输出,它默认返回全部结果。 在 WEB 模式下控制输出格式用 phpconfigcheck.php?...列表顶部状态行会显示问题数量。 image.png

82510

【问底】静行:FastJSON实现详解

Filter列表 SerializeWriter中有很多Filter列表,可视为在生成json各阶段、各地方定制序列化,大致如下: BeforeFilter :序列化时在最前面添加内容 AfterFilter...,或者clazz就是Object.class JSONType注解指明不适用ASM createASMSerializer加载失败 结合前面的讨论,可以得出使用ASM条件:Android系统、基础类...先根据fieldType获取缓存解析,如果没有则根据fieldClass获取缓存解析,否则根据注解JSONType获取解析,否则通过当前线程加载加载AutowiredObjectDeserializer...使用asm条件如下: Android系统 该类及其除Object之外所有父类为是public 泛型参数asmFactory加载之外加载加载接口类 类setter函数不大于...,比如对排序json串可按顺序匹配解析,从而减少读取token数,如上要求也是蛮严格

1.4K70

前50个Python面试问题(最受欢迎)

但是,您可以使用List收集类型,该类型可以存储无限数量元素。 #11)鉴于Python最适合服务端应用程序,您如何实现JSON? 答: Python内置了处理JSON对象支持。...您只需要导入JSON模块并使用诸如加载和转储之类功能即可将JSON字符串转换为JSON对象,反之亦然。这是从服务端处理和交换基于JSON数据直接方法。...PYTHONSTARTUP:此环境变量包含包含源代码初始化文件路径。 PYTHONCASEOK:此变量用于在导入语句中查找第一个不区分大小写匹配项 #27)什么是Python元组?...答: abs()是一个内置函数,它也可用于整数,浮点数和复数。 fabs()是在数学模块中定义不适用于复数。...* args用于传递关键字可变长度参数列表,而* kwargs用于传递关键字可变长度参数列表

5.1K30

Usbrip:用于跟踪USB设备固件简单CLI取证工具

它是用纯Python 3编写一小块软件(使用一些外部模块,参见Dependencies / PIP),它解析Linux日志文件(/var/log/syslog或/var/log/messages 取决于发行版...此类表格可能包含以下列:“ 连接”(日期和时间),“用户”,“VID”(供应商ID),“PID”(产品ID),“产品”,“制造商”,“序列号”, “端口”和“断开连接”(日期和时间)。...此外,它还可以: 导出收集信息作为JSON转储(当然,打开这样转储); 生成一个授权(可信)USB设备列表作为JSON(称之为auth.json); 根据以下内容搜索“违规事件” auth.json...:show(或生成另一个JSON)USB设备出现在历史记录中并且不会出现在auth.json; 使用-sflag 安装时,创建加密存储(7zip存档),以便在crontab调度程序帮助下自动备份和累积...) usbrip&& cd usbrip~/usbrip$ 由于usbrip仅适用于系统日志文件修改结构,因此,如果更改syslogs格式(例如,syslog-ng或者)rsyslog,它将无法解析

99520

Python无框架分布式爬虫,爬取范例:拼多多商品详情数据,拼多多商品列表数据

本文将介绍拼多多商品数据采集技术。 一、拼多多商品数据结构 拼多多商品数据包含了以下信息: 商品标题:商品名称,主要描述商品基本属性。 ...商品ID:商品唯一标识符,用于区分不同商品,具有唯一性。 商品价格:商品售价和原价,包括折扣信息和团购价等。商品图片:商品图片信息,包括主图和详情图等。...该方法适合采集小批量商品数据,但不适用于大规模数据采集。手动采集需要手动输入搜索词,进行筛选后再复制所需数据,该方法需要花费大量时间和人力成本,效率较低。 ...(3)处理网页:使用beautiful soup等库,对网页中商品数据进行解析,提取自己所需要数据。(4)存储数据:一般采用文件存储和数据库存储两种方式。...2.封装接口进行采集拼多多商品详情数据,拼多多商品优惠券数据,拼多多商品视频数据,拼多多商品销量数据,拼多多商品列表数据代码展示:2.1 请求方式:HTTP  POST  GET 2.2 公共参数: 名称类型必须描述

78120

利用Python爬虫某招聘网站岗位信息

---- 故事聊完了,咱们开工吧 1、前期准备 因为是爬虫,所以咱们需要用到如下几个库 requests fake_useragent json pandas Requests 介绍是这样: 唯一一个转基因...Request库内部生成, 这时候res返回是一个包含服务资源Response对象,包含从服务返回所有的相关资源。...json 就是上期我们本来打算介绍但是换了一个库实现 用于处理json数据,可以将编码 JSON 字符串解码为 Python 对象 pandas 是我们老朋友了,因为常和excel打交道,对表格钟爱...3)理清原始数据结构 当我们获取到数据来源url之后,就需要理清这些原始数据长啥样,如此才好去解析整理出想要信息。打开一个url,我们发现是一个json,嗯,很完整多层json。...= response_comment.text json_comment = json.loads(json_comment) 3)数据筛选 接上个for循环,因为每页内有20条数据,因此需要再用一个循环取出每条数据并存入一个空字典中

84440

22 个最常用Python包

最大优点之一是它可以获取包列表,通常以requirements.txt文件形式获取。该文件能选择包含所需版本详细规范。大多数 Python 项目都包含这样文件。...据悉,应用程序中国际化域名(IDNA)是一种用来处理包含 ASCII 字符域名机制。但是,原始域名系统已经提供对基于 ASCII 字符域名支持。所以,哪有问题?  ...它设计宗旨是让人类和计算机都能很容易地阅读代码——人类很容易读写它内容,计算机也可以解析它。  PyYAML是 Python YAML解析和发射,这意味着它可以读写YAML。...futures 包是该库适用于 Python 2 backport。它不适用于 Python3 用户,因为 Python 3 原生提供了该模块。  ...实际上,Python json就是simplejson。但是simplejson也有一些优点:  它适用于更多 Python 版本。它比 Python 更新频率更频繁。

1.1K20

有比JSON更好东西吗?

用户: Google,Cocos2D,Facebook移动客户端 优点: 专为零拷贝反序列化而设计 专为架构而设计 缺点: 相同问题已经由Capnp解决 出于某种原因包括JSON解析?...用户:少数,尤其是Amethyst.rs 优点: 适用于复杂功能样式语言良好类型系统 简单合理紧凑 实际上非常擅长 缺点: 年轻,规格不足,以Rust为中心 ---- bincode https:/...它不是在不能保证稳定性单个特定实现之外进行标准化,因此不适用于通用用途。它旨在用作Servo快速简便RPC / IPC格式,而实际格式基本上是该目标的实现细节。...合理简单好看 缺点: 轻快的人会喜欢它,轻快的人会讨厌它。 对于列表以外复合数据类型,实际上没有公认语法。...人们实际上关心大多数事物都是对XML响应,因此这就是开始地方。最广泛使用事物家谱将是: ---- JSON替代品 因此,当实际查看此列表时,实际上并没有JSON替代品。

4.3K30

22 个最常用Python包

最大优点之一是它可以获取包列表,通常以requirements.txt文件形式获取。该文件能选择包含所需版本详细规范。大多数 Python 项目都包含这样文件。...据悉,应用程序中国际化域名(IDNA)是一种用来处理包含 ASCII 字符域名机制。但是,原始域名系统已经提供对基于 ASCII 字符域名支持。所以,哪有问题? ?...它设计宗旨是让人类和计算机都能很容易地阅读代码——人类很容易读写它内容,计算机也可以解析它。 ? PyYAML是 Python YAML解析和发射,这意味着它可以读写YAML。...futures 包是该库适用于 Python 2 backport。它不适用于 Python3 用户,因为 Python 3 原生提供了该模块。...实际上,Python json就是simplejson。但是simplejson也有一些优点: 它适用于更多 Python 版本。 它比 Python 更新频率更频繁。

1.8K10

Sentry 监控 - Snuba 数据中台架构(Query Processing 简介)

查询处理阶段 本节介绍了上述各阶段代码和示例,并提供了一些提示。 Legacy 和 SnQL 解析 Snuba 支持两种语言,传统基于 JSON 语言和新名为 SnQL 语言。...https://github.com/getsentry/snuba/tree/master/snuba/query 基于 JSON 语言旧解析源码: https://github.com/getsentry...一般验证由一组检查组成,这些检查在解析生成查询之后立即应用于每个查询。这在 QueryEntity 函数中发生。...https://github.com/getsentry/snuba/blob/master/snuba/web/split.py 时间拆分(Time splitting)将一个查询(不包含聚合且正确排序...复合查询处理 上面的讨论仅适用于简单查询、复合查询(连接和包含子查询查询遵循稍微不同路径)。 上面讨论简单查询管道不适用于连接查询或包含子查询查询。

79210

一个小时就搭好属于自己博客

:整个博客配置 db.json:source解析所得到 package.json:项目所需模块项目的配置信息 3、博客生成 只需要三句话你就能看到你博客 1、清除hexo clean 2、生成hexo...public/默认情况下,该文件夹不是(也不应该)上传,请确保该.gitignore文件包含public/行。...2、语法 前题是文件开头YAML或JSON块,用于配置作品设置。使用YAML编写时,前题以三个破折号结尾,而使用JSON编写时,则以三个分号结尾。...默认 layout 布局 title 标题 文件名(仅帖子) date 发布日期 文件创建日期 updated 更新日期 文件更新日期 comments 为帖子启用评论功能 true tags 标签(不适用于页面...) categories 类别(不适用于页面) permalink 覆盖帖子默认永久链接 keywords 仅在meta标签和Open Graph中使用关键字(不推荐) 分类和标签 只有帖子支持类别和标签使用

92720

编码与模式------《Designing Data-Intensive Applications》读书笔记5

1.二进制编码格式 程序通常以至少两种不同表示方式处理数据: 1、在内存中,数据是保存在对象、结构、列表、数组、哈希表、树、等等。...XML描述十分精准,但是因过于冗长。 JSON流行主要归功于它在Web浏览内置支持(由于它是JavaScript一个子集)和相对于XML简单性。...Binary格式 Binary格式编码之后为59个字节大小,并且每个字段都有一个类型注释(用于指示它是字符串、整数、列表等),并在需要时指定长度指示(字符串长度、列表中项数量)。...数据类型 如何改变字段数据类型?例如,将32位整数转换为64位整数。新代码可以很容易地读取旧代码编写数据,因为解析可以用零填充任何丢失位。...但是,如果旧代码读取由新代码编写数据,旧代码仍然使用32位变量来保存值。如果解码64位值不适合32位,会被截断。 Protocolbuf并没有一个列表或数组数据类型,而是有一个重复标记字段。

1.3K40

浅谈Android客户端与服务数据交互总结

前言: 本文总结了Android客户端与服务进行交互时,采用RESTful API +Json交互方式,针对不同数据形式以及不同解析方法,如有不足之处,欢迎指正。...Android客户端与服务数据交互方式 主要有三种: 数据流 从web服务响应到手机终端数据 一般打包在一个字节数组中,这个字节数据中包含了不同数据类型,客端端采取Java数据流和过虑流方式从字节数组中取出各种类型数据...关于服务开发规范,我们先来了解一下。 服务开发规范 我们采用是 RESTful,RESTful是目前最流流行 API设计规范,用于web数据接口设计。 3....或 false Array:数组包含在方括号[]中 Object:对象包含在大括号{}中 Null:空类型 传输数据类型不能超过这六种数据类型,不能用Date数据类型,不同解析解析方式不同,可能会导致异常...671 ], } 此时数据 不同于上面提到几种Json数据类型,返回列表中 数据没有key,只有value值 。

6.7K41

PHP5.2至5.6新增功能详解

(例如以上代码仅仅适用于MySQL),PHP 官方设计了 PDO.除此之外,PDO 还提供了更多功能,比如: 面向对象风格接口 SQL预编译(prepare), 占位符语法 更高执行效率,作为官方推荐...(可执行类型) 以及 array(数组), 不适用于 string 和 int. // 限制第一个参数为 MyClass, 第二个参数为可执行类型,第三个参数为数组 function MyFunction...// 命名空间中可以包含任意代码,只有 **类, 函数, 常量** 受命名空间影响。...旧式风格: define("XOOO", "Value"); 新式风格: const XXOO = "Value"; const 形式仅适用于常量,不适用于运行时才能求值表达式: // 正确 const...注:http://www.php.net/manual/zh/language.oop5.traits.php 内置 Web 服务 PHP从5.4开始内置一个轻量级Web服务,不支持并发,定位是用于开发和调试环境

3.7K20
领券